Court rejects widow’s attempted rape claims

Clotilder Mwanza

A 56-YEAR-OLD widow has lost her bid for a peace order against her neighbour whom she was accusing of attempted rape.

Joyce Ndirihwani also accused her neighbour, Fungai Cheza, of physical and verbal abuse.

She, however, failed to convince magistrate, Rutendo Machingura, with compelling evidence.

Joyce lacked confidence during the court hearing.

“I want my neighbour not to physically and verbally abuse me. 

“He has been asking for sexual favours since last year.

“Last week, he tried to rape me at my house. 

“I reported him to the police then I was advised to apply for a peace order,” said Joyce.

“I am now afraid of him because he might kill me. 

“Last month, he assaulted me at a borehole. I do not love him because he has nothing to offer. “I have a brother in the UK who takes care of me.”

However, Fungai dismissed Joyce’s testimony.

Fungai Cheza

He said he could not have attempted to rape her since they had an affair before.

“We once cohabited for two months after my wife passed away. 

“I later married someone who I am currently staying with.

“Yes, I went to her house asking for sexual intercourse, it’s normal, because we had a relationship before, I did not insult or assault her,” Fungai said.
